Heya Guys, during the Dragon Boat outing, 3 of us noticed that my D300 battery indicator went wonky a bit (it read as empty several times).

Apparently, Nikon has now released a new firmware for D300 to address this issue :D

Saw this at DPReview, someone called it "Dead Battery Syndrome" for D300 :bsmilie:
